PhD Agriculture Economics: What it is About?

PhD Agriculture Economics is basically a doctorate degree in which the learners are exposed to quantitative analysis integrated with critical thinking of agricultural policies and business.

  • The students get familiar with all the developments as well as innovations in agriculture field that can drive it towards greater business. 
  • The course provides intensive training in application of quantitative methods as well as economic theory to economic issues of rural areas as well as food sector.
  • The program provides learners with better career opportunities in different areas like academia, agribusiness, consulting firms, financial institutions, government, or non-governmental organizations. 
  • The course would enable them to predict the market trends of agro-based products.

What is the PhD Agriculture Economics Admission Process?

The admission procedure for PhD Agriculture Economics is different for different institutes. In some cases, the admission is conducted directly where the candidates are selected on merit basis. In some other Institutes, the candidates are required to appear for the entrance tests or interviews in order to fulfill the admission process.

Merit Based Admissions

  • The willing candidates should read the instructions properly from the college or university website before filling the application form. 
  • After submitting the form, the candidates should wait for the merit lists to be published.

Entrance Based Admission

If the admission is based on entrance examination, then candidates need to register themselves and need to fill the form with all details. The candidates should obtain the minimum marks as required for the admission.

PhD Agriculture Economics Entrance Exams

Entrance tests for admission to PhD Agriculture Economics are mentioned below:

  • UGC NET: This exam is a national level examination for getting admission in a PhD programme.
  • OUAT Common Entrance Exam- The Orissa University Agriculture and Technology conducts this exam every year for admission to UG, PG , PhD programmes.  Through this examination, the candidates can get admission in Agriculture, Horticulture, Veterinary science and animal husbandry, fields.
  • ICAR: It’s an All-India Entrance Examination conducted for granting admission in PhD programme in agriculture sciences.

PhD Agriculture Economics : Job Prospects

With PhD Agriculture Economics, the candidates will have plenty of career opportunities in Public Sectors, Private Sectors, Field Of Veterinary Management And Medicine, Academic Institutes Etc.

Job Profile Description of Role Average Annual Salary
Agriculture Consultant Gives advice on agriculture lands INR 5 lacs
Research Investigator Conduct basic research works in laboratories or in the field and apply the results to such tasks as increasing crops and animal yields in order to improve the environment. INR 6.2 lacs
Farming Manager Monitoring staff, crops, purchasing supplies; preparing budgets etc. INR 9.44 lacs
Commodity Analyst Make forecasts regarding commodity market. INR 7.5 lacs

Fee Structure And Facilities

Fees for the college is on a expensive side. The course Agri-economics has an annual fee of Rs. 85,000/-, which is to be paid at the beginning of the academic year itself. Besides this, students who opt for hostel facility will have to pay the hostel charges which are approximately Rs. 15,000/- per annum.The course fee is slightly expensive as compared to market standards.

Placement Experience

The institute is known for its research and placements are not the priority. However, there are few corporates who visits the college during the placement week and offer salaries ranging between Rs. 4,00,000 per month to Rs. 9,00,000 per month. Some of the companies who visit for placements are NABARD, EXIM BANK, E Clerics, ZS Associate, BAIF, etc.
